Functional comparison of EncB and EncC cargo proteins in iron storage within the Myxococcus xanthus encapsulin

open access: yesFEBS Letters, EarlyView.
Encapsulins are protein nanocompartments that play an important role in iron storage. In the Myxococcus xanthus encapsulin system, two cargo proteins called EncB and EncC contribute to iron mineralization. Here, we show that EncB and EncC generate iron‐containing minerals with distinct chemical compositions, suggesting that the composition of stored ...

Comparison of Model Systems (M+)n·[CrX63−] and M3CrX6 + 18MX Based on Quantum-Chemical Calculations (X: F, Cl)

open access: yesJournal of Chemistry, 2016
On the basis of quantum-chemical calculations the most stable particle compositions are estimated in such model systems as (M+)n·[CrCl6] and M3CrCl6 + 18MCl (M = Na, K, and Cs). In all systems these particles are positively charged.

Evaluating the effect of γ‐oryzanol on MASLD pathology using a medaka fish model

open access: yesFEBS Open Bio, EarlyView.
This study explores a liver disease called MASLD, which is increasing worldwide and can lead to serious damage. Researchers used medaka fish instead of rodents to test a food compound, γ‐oryzanol. Fish fed this compound had less liver fat and healthier gut bacteria.

Protocol for quantifying miRNA trafficking across the endosomal membrane

open access: yesFEBS Open Bio, EarlyView.
An in vitro protocol measures miRNA uptake into endosomes isolated from mammalian cell extracts, which are free of subcellular contaminants. Performed at 37 °C in the presence of ATP, it ensures the import of single‐stranded miRNA into the endosomal lumen.
